1. Write a quadratic equation that can be solved by factoring. Solve your equation and show and explain all your work. 2. How do

you determine which method to use when you’re trying to solve a quadratic equation?

X²+8x+15 is the quadratic equation and it can be solved by factoring. By factoring the answer will be (x+3) (x+5) and if it is expanded, the answer will be x²+8x+15. First, you should factorize the equation. Then, find the two numbers that if they are added together the sum will 8 and if they are multiplied the product is 15.
